Tsuruki Trading (鶴木貿易, Tsuruki bōeki?) is a midsized trading company.[2]

Description[]

The firm is established after the Meiji Restoration.[2] It is run by the Usuba family under their Tsuruki identity,[3] and serves as their main income.[4] Arata Usuba currently works as a senior negotiator for the company.[2][5]

The firm's headquarters is located in the Imperial Capital, a few minutes away from the Usuba estate.[5]

History[]

About twenty years ago, the company was on the verge of bankruptcy following declining business.[2] The management at the time failed in negotiations with a major business partner and the company was performing very poorly, the worst since the founding of the company. The family was facing a mountain of debt that was beyond their means. The situation was very dire.[4]

Just before the whole family was about to be forced into the streets, the head of the Saimori family somehow heard of their plight and offered a marriage arrangement in exchange for financial support.[5] They would take on a large amount of the debt if the daughter of the Usuba family, Sumi Usuba, would marry their son, Shinichi Saimori.[4] At the time, the head of the Usuba family, Yoshirou Usuba, could see that the Saimoris were heading into decline and never wanted to hand his precious daughter over to a family like them.[5] He was against the marriage and rejected the offer, but the Saimoris were persistent and would keep sending proposals. Ultimately, in order to save her family, Sumi overcame Yoshirou’s objections and accepted their offer without consulting Yoshirou.[4]

Later, it is revealed that the Emperor was behind this period of economic slump for the company. Fearing the power of Dream-Sight after Sumi was born with Telepathy, he wanted to weaken the Usubas’ power. Even if a Gift-user with Dream-Sight would be born, they wouldn’t pose a threat while the Usuba family was on the verge of ruin. The Emperor used his influence behind the scenes to ensure business went poorly for Tsuruki Trading. The Usuba family was then pushed to the brink of extinction.[3]

After Sumi went to marry the Saimoris in order to save the family, the family received financial assistance from the Saimoris.[5] The money is later revealed to have come from the Emperor, who passed the Saimoris a heavy sum, and incited them into pursuing Sumi. He couldn’t care less whether the Usubas recovered or faded away thereafter. All that mattered was separating the woman from her family; as he feared that Sumi would otherwise marry another member of the Usuba family and produce a child thick with Usuba blood, causing the stronger the power of Dream-Sight in the child would be. The Saimoris were almost entirely lacking in Gift-users, and their fall from nobility was clearly on the horizon.[3]

The Tsuruki Trading company has since recovered and is now stable.[2]
